This comic is very down to earth and realistic. There's a dash of quirkiness in the use of clever metaphors to describe daily things that makes it feel refreshing and interesting to read. The art is soothing and easy on the eyes.
The story is character-focused, but this focus shifts every season. This does not stay a story about Eunjo and Wan Jo, as the description might suggest. In every season, the story explores the relationship of a new ML and FL pair. Arcs have open endings and are somewhat anti-climactic, with previous protagonists fading into the background.
